[youtube]http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=SWmh-u7X2Uc[/youtube] The Hollywood Edge is showcasing three new SFX libraries at NAMM, including the following titles: Mechanical Morphs A must have for sci-fi and fantasy sound design. A library of 1372 sound effects recorded and mastered at 96kHz/24/Bit by two talented sound designers: Jim Stout and Richard Devine. Includes a lot of … [Read more...]

The Hollywood Edge had an interesting interview with Alan Howarth, a composer and sound designer who has participated in various projects, from scores to special sound effects, working on several films such as Star Trek, The Omega Code, The Mask, Dracula, Poltergeist, The Final Countdown, and many more.
